However, in addition to manually uninstalling the membership levels, did you do this before uninstalling?

Dashboard -› s2Member® -› General Options -› Deactivation Safeguards

disable the safeguards, then you can uninstall. which should then remove all s2 options etc.

If not, maybe try reinstalling it and then doing this:
Dashboard -› s2Member® -› General Options -› Deactivation Safeguards

disable the safeguards, then you can uninstall. which should then remove all s2 options etc.

then, uninstalling the membership levels (if they appear again) manually last.

Try it out and let me know…

I think that worked for me and I don’t see any trace of s2member (as far as I know).
